The EHL community is grieving the profound loss of Léo Sanglard, one of the young victims of the tragic New Year’s Eve fire at a Swiss bar in Crans-Montana. Léo’s passing has left an indelible mark on those who knew him, as his kindness, warmth, and genuine spirit touched the lives of many.
While Léo’s time with us was far too brief, the memory of his laughter, compassion, and generosity will endure in the hearts of friends, classmates, and the wider EHL community.
